Tests were carried out on multidielectric stacks of PbF2 - MgF2 thin films with a view to applying these in an ultraviolet camera for stellar spectral analysis. Selective mirrors for the near ultraviolet were realized using these coatings, and tested. Aging tests proved to be not entirely satisfactory. Interference filters were also realized and tested for Mg II beam detection (2802 angstrom) for use in a balloon. A blocking was noted, however, for visible light, possibly due to the MgF2. It is concluded that such filters with predetermined characteristics cannot be realized based on PbF2 and MgF2.
